    Confusion on Mojo SDI

     I've been hearing differernt things about the mojo in regards to displaying HD material on a SD client monitor.

    Does the Mojo downconver the material or does the Avid? Is it an automatic downconvert or would I have to manually downconvert it in order to view it on the client monitor.

    Re: Confusion on Mojo SDI

    PlayaDelRey:
    Does the Mojo downconver the material or does the Avid? Is it an automatic downconvert or would I have to manually downconvert it in order to view it on the client monitor.

    Both the original Mojo and the Mojo SDI behave the same way (regarding HD material):

    It will automatically downconvert some HD formats - provided you switch the project's "Format Tab" to the standard SD video rate.

    The details are:

    • 1080i/59.94 can convert to NTSC 30i (720 and all flavors of 24 are not supported, and I think PAL has problems)
    • You only get a single field on your video display through the Mojo.
    • You have to remember to switch your project Format Tab back to 1080i when you are finished viewing your stuff on the display or all of your titles, effects, imports and digitizing will be at 30i from that point on.

    Its not really very useful - it basically sucks for any kind of HD work. You are far better off looking into a Decklink card or an MXO box and using Avid's "Fullscreen" option - which allows for both SD and HD realtime screening without having to switch your Format. Fullscreen is limited by your computer's processing and graphics card - so your milage may vary using Fullscreen.
